Output 15dc50fd178ac190666cdd14977116eb5d28aefb9b5be05599bbbc2930284001:16

value
18725985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b425da812e6ccf216c89b4332cf8e622455bc5f4 OP_EQUAL
address
3J7YuBZP829yR1UoZFZmJfCcCfCvTnyceu
transaction
15dc50fd178ac190666cdd14977116eb5d28aefb9b5be05599bbbc2930284001
spent
true